National Maritime Museum
Britain’s seafaring history is displayed in this modern museum. Learn about Nelson, maritime uniforms, 20th century sea power and even the future of the sea. Other themes include exploration and discovery, trade and exploration, and maritime London.

Why go?
The massive collection of navigation and timekeeping instruments, charts and maps, coins and medals, ship and weapon models, as well as uniforms and art, is amazing.
The National Maritime Museum is also part of
Maritime Greenwich World Heritage
site.
